0

ああ、この loadlibrary("MSVCR90d.dll") の何が問題なのかわかりません。

常に 0x00000000 を返します。

ここにコードがあります。

HModule hMod = LoadLibrary("MSVCR90D.dll");

私にその理由を教えてください。

< 簡単に MFC アプリケーション プログラムを作成しました。>

4

1 に答える 1

1

失敗した後に電話をかけてGetLastError()、もう少し情報を入手してください。アプリがそれを見つけられないか、DLL自体の依存関係が見つからないかのいずれかです。

Dependency Walkerをインストールし、MSVCR90D.dllを右クリックして[依存関係の表示]を選択し、そのDLL自体が正常にロードできるかどうかを確認します。

于 2012-08-10T10:25:23.753 に答える